A New Path Forward for Chronic Pain

The PATH program helps participants develop sustainable strategies for living well with the pain that they have. The program’s “whole person” approach melds conventional medical and mental health treatment with weekly group work and alternative therapies.

Climb Out of the Darkness

According to Postpartum Support International, postpartum depression affects 1 in 7 new mothers and 1 in ten dads. The numbers are even more daunting for people of color, affecting 1 in 3 new mothers.
